Evolution of Online Gambling

The roots of online gambling can be traced back to the mid-1990s when the first online casinos emerged. Technological advancements and the widespread availability of the internet paved the way for a new era of gambling, allowing players to enjoy their favorite games from the comfort of their homes. Over the years, online gambling has evolved, incorporating live dealer games, virtual reality experiences, and mobile compatibility to enhance the overall gaming experience.

Types of Online Gambling

  1. Online Casinos: These platforms offer a wide array of traditional casino games such as slots, blackjack, roulette, poker, and more. The games are powered by random number generators (RNGs) to ensure fairness.
  2. Sports Betting: Online sportsbooks enable users to place bets on various sporting events, from football and basketball to horse racing and eSports.
  3. Online Poker Rooms: Players can join virtual poker tables, competing against others in tournaments or cash games.
  4. Online Bingo and Lottery: Bingo enthusiasts can enjoy their favorite game online, and lottery platforms offer a digital alternative to traditional ticket purchases.
  5. Live Dealer Games: Many online casinos now offer live dealer games, where real croupiers host games like blackjack and roulette in real-time via video streaming.

Challenges and Disadvantages

  1. Addiction Risk: The accessibility of online gambling can lead to addiction, as individuals may find it challenging to set limits on their gaming activities.
  2. Regulatory Concerns: The regulatory landscape for online gambling varies globally, and some regions face challenges in establishing effective frameworks to ensure fair play and responsible gambling.
  3. Technical Issues: Players may encounter technical glitches, such as connectivity issues or software malfunctions, which can disrupt the gaming experience.
  4. Lack of Social Interaction: Online gambling lacks the social aspect of traditional casinos, as players miss out on the camaraderie and social interactions that come with a physical gaming environment.
